Meet
Mrs. Heidi Polcha-Geniviva
Wee Wisdom Founder and Owner
I began creating the Wee Wisdom Curriculum in 1998. Starting in the fall of 1999, I spent twelve years running Wee Wisdom Preschool at Notre Dame School. When they combined with St. Joseph's School, I incorporated the business and came to this church to rent space and have thoroughly enjoyed watching the business grow and flourish. The program is a "living" creation always growing and changing to keep up with the advances in education. My bachelor's degree in education is from Westminster College and I did my student teaching at West Middlesex Schools. While I specialize in curriculum development, I firmly believe in nurturing the whole child and addressing their growth spiritually, emotionally, and socially.
